The Challenges of Learning Engineering

Diane Litman is a computer science professor, a senior scientist with the Learning Research and Development Center, and faculty of the Intelligent Systems Program all at the University of Pittsburgh. In this video, she highlights some of the challenges that are common to encounter in learning engineering. She talks about concerns for student privacy, the ethics of good research design, and considerations of bias in machine learning algorithms.
